This article analyzes the development of theatricality and its concepts and characteristics to let readers understand the conceptual development of "theatricality." It was first used in art by Michael Fred in his "Art and Art" in 1967.The term’theatricality’was put forward in "Objectiveness" to criticize the "objectiveness" in minimalism.From some concepts,I analyzed that theatricality has the characteristics of comprehensiveness,on-siteness and media.And emphatically analyzes the way of expression of "theatricality" in painting creation,which has the characteristics of multiple narratives,sense of ritual and metonymy.Through the mastery of these characteristics and the analysis of examples,first through the comparative analysis of the multiple narratives in Bosch’s "Early Paradise" and Gu Kaizhi’s "Fu of Luo Shen",it is found that there are different methods for the use of multiple narratives in painting.In particular,the structure of the screen and the arrangement of characters in "Fu of Luo Shen" to the scroll-like display method are full of a static theater feeling.Later,I took Michelangelo’s "Genesis Murals" and Dunhuang Mogao Grottoes 257 Caves as examples to analyze the construction of the sense of ritual,and concluded that their advantage in theatrical painting lies in the setting of the pictures and its It presents the locality and sense of the scene of the space,and paintings in this space can bring more feelings to everyone,and they have different ways of processing the composition of the picture,which can increase our understanding of the form to a certain extent.Sensitive sensitivity.Then we analyzed Chen Hongshou’s "Yin Mei Tu" and Kentridge’s works in the Ming Dynasty,and found that Chen Hongshou focused on personal theater expression and adopted a small narrative style,focusing on personal emotions.The content refers to one’s inner emotions through the image of the characters on the screen.And Kentridge’s work has a form of humanistic care and a social theater in it,like a social painting theater,full of realistic humanistic care,based on experiences in real life,with a peaceful presence.Sense,communicate with the viewer,and metaphor a kind of social reality through changing images.After that,through reflection and introduction to some theater paintings in my own creations,and an introduction to the images,colors,forms,techniques,etc.in my works,I added some current painting cases to theater paintings.It also allowed me to sort out the development context of my painting creation,enrich the creation logic and creation methods of my works,and at the same time reflect on myself.In the final conclusion,I concluded that “theatricality” painting has a kind of openness,which I think is the core point of theatrical painting.
